Timber Framing in NZ
NZ uses NZS 3604 (Timber-framed buildings) as the primary standard for residential construction. Most framing uses H1.2 treated radiata pine (formerly CCA, now usually H1.2 boron treatment).
Standard Wall Frame Specs
- Studs: 90×45mm @ 600mm centres (or 400mm for bracing walls)
- Top plate: 90×45mm × 2 (double top plate)
- Bottom plate: 90×45mm × 1
- Noggings: 90×45mm @ mid-height (approx 1.2m)
- Lintels: Sized by span and load — always check NZS 3604 tables
H Grade Treatments
| Grade | Use |
|---|---|
| H1.2 | Interior framing (boron treated) |
| H3.1 | Above-ground exterior, weatherboard |
| H3.2 | Above-ground, severe exposure |
| H4 | In-ground, not critical |
| H5 | In-ground, long service life |
All structural building work requires an LBP-licensed builder.
